Output 9860fd64d6967dd37d288791eed2d75bd2f6c29cc17f64f29bafeb212b89152c:43

value
22066
script pubkey
OP_0 OP_PUSHBYTES_20 627eddcfc201b05b3e5e6e538bf159dd160389f7
address
bc1qvfldmn7zqxc9k0j7defchu2em5tq8z0hljky24
transaction
9860fd64d6967dd37d288791eed2d75bd2f6c29cc17f64f29bafeb212b89152c
confirmations
183865
spent
true